[PATCH v2 2/5] ASoC: dt-bindings: fsl,easrc: add ports binding for multiple conversion paths

The i.MX EASRC hardware supports up to four conversion contexts
(A, B, C, D). Add a ports container property to the binding to allow
each independent conversion path to be represented as an individual
audio-graph port:

  port@0 -- conversion path 0
  port@1 -- conversion path 1
  port@2 -- conversion path 2
  port@3 -- conversion path 3

Each sub-port references audio-graph-port.yaml and follows the standard
audio-graph binding conventions. Contexts are allocated dynamically at
stream open time; each active stream direction (playback or capture) on
a port consumes one hardware context.

diff --git a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/sound/fsl,easrc.yaml b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/sound/fsl,easrc.yaml
index d5727f8bfb0b..e6d7cae5983d 100644
--- a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/sound/fsl,easrc.yaml
+++ b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/sound/fsl,easrc.yaml
@@ -55,6 +55,14 @@ properties:
       - const: imx/easrc/easrc-imx8mn.bin
     description: The coefficient table for the filters
 
+  ports:
+    $ref: /schemas/graph.yaml#/properties/ports
+    patternProperties:
+      "^port@[0-3]$":
+        $ref: audio-graph-port.yaml#
+        unevaluatedProperties: false
+        description: port for an independent conversion path
+
   fsl,asrc-rate:
     $ref: /schemas/types.yaml#/definitions/uint32
     minimum: 8000
@@ -107,3 +115,63 @@ examples:
         fsl,asrc-rate = <8000>;
         fsl,asrc-format = <2>;
     };
+
+  - |
+    #include <dt-bindings/interrupt-controller/arm-gic.h>
+    #include <dt-bindings/clock/imx8mn-clock.h>
+
+    easrc1: easrc@300c0000 {
+        compatible = "fsl,imx8mn-easrc";
+        reg = <0x300c0000 0x10000>;
+        interrupts = <GIC_SPI 122 IRQ_TYPE_LEVEL_HIGH>;
+        clocks = <&clk IMX8MN_CLK_ASRC_ROOT>;
+        clock-names = "mem";
+        dmas = <&sdma2 16 23 0> , <&sdma2 17 23 0>,
+               <&sdma2 18 23 0> , <&sdma2 19 23 0>,
+               <&sdma2 20 23 0> , <&sdma2 21 23 0>,
+               <&sdma2 22 23 0> , <&sdma2 23 23 0>;
+        dma-names = "ctx0_rx", "ctx0_tx",
+                    "ctx1_rx", "ctx1_tx",
+                    "ctx2_rx", "ctx2_tx",
+                    "ctx3_rx", "ctx3_tx";
+        firmware-name = "imx/easrc/easrc-imx8mn.bin";
+        fsl,asrc-rate = <8000>;
+        fsl,asrc-format = <2>;
+
+        ports {
+            #address-cells = <1>;
+            #size-cells = <0>;
+
+            port@0 {
+                reg = <0>;
+                playback-only;
+                easrc1_endpoint0: endpoint {
+                    remote-endpoint = <&fe00_ep>;
+                };
+            };
+
+            port@1 {
+                reg = <1>;
+                playback-only;
+                easrc1_endpoint1: endpoint {
+                    remote-endpoint = <&fe01_ep>;
+                };
+            };
+
+            port@2 {
+                reg = <2>;
+                capture-only;
+                easrc1_endpoint2: endpoint {
+                    remote-endpoint = <&fe02_ep>;
+                };
+            };
+
+            port@3 {
+                reg = <3>;
+                capture-only;
+                easrc1_endpoint3: endpoint {
+                    remote-endpoint = <&fe03_ep>;
+                };
+            };
+        };
+    };
